Fitter distributions python

WebJun 6, 2024 · The Fitter class in the backend uses the Scipy library which supports 80 distributions and the Fitter class will scan all of them, call the fit function for you, ignoring those that fail or...

fitter · PyPI

Web16 rows · Jan 1, 2024 · Compatible with Python 3.7, and 3.8, 3.9. What is it ? fitter … Webfitter module reference¶. main module of the fitter package. class fitter.fitter.Fitter (data, xmin=None, xmax=None, bins=100, distributions=None, timeout=30, density=True) [source] ¶. Fit a data sample to known distributions. A naive approach often performed to figure out the undelying distribution that could have generated a data set, is to compare … share between pc and iphone https://comperiogroup.com

numpy - Fitting to Poisson histogram - Stack Overflow

WebJul 10, 2016 · 6. There is no distribution called weibull in scipy. There are weibull_min, weibull_max and exponweib. weibull_min is the one that matches the wikipedia article on the Weibull distribuition. weibull_min has three parameters: c (shape), loc (location) and scale (scale). c and scale correspond to k and λ in the wikipedia article, respectively. WebThe fitter.fitter.Fitter.summary () method shows the first best distributions (in terms of fitting). Once the fitting is performed, one may want to get the parameters corresponding to the best distribution. The parameters are … WebApr 11, 2024 · With a Bayesian model we don't just get a prediction but a population of predictions. Which yields the plot you see in the cover image. Now we will replicate this … share between pc and android

image - Thresholding and circle fitting in Python - Stack Overflow

Category:GitHub - cokelaer/fitter: Fit data to many distributions

Tags:Fitter distributions python

Fitter distributions python

Fitting a histogram with python - Stack Overflow

WebUPDATE: I realized the method I used in this video, called fit() is only included for CONTINUOUS distributions (normal, gamma, exponential, etc) in SciPy. If... WebNov 23, 2024 · Binned Least Squares Method to Fit the Poisson Distribution in Python In this example, a dummy Poisson dataset is created, and a histogram is plotted with this …

Fitter distributions python

Did you know?

WebApr 2, 2024 · First step: we can define the corresponding distribution distribution = ot.UserDefined (ot.Sample ( [ [s] for s in x_axis]), y_axis) graph = distribution.drawPDF () graph.setColors ( ["black"]) graph.setLegends ( ["your input"]) at this stage, if you View (graph) you would get: Second step: we can derive a sample from the obtained distibution Web16 rows · The fitter package is a Python library for fitting probability distributions to data. It provides a simple and intuitive interface for estimating the parameters of different types … fitter module reference¶. main module of the fitter package. class fitter.fitter.Fitter …

WebJun 2, 2024 · Fitting your data to the right distribution is valuable and might give you some insight about it. SciPy is a Python library with many mathematical and statistical tools ready to be used and... Webdistfit is a python package for probability density fitting of univariate distributions for random variables. With the random variable as an input, distfit can find the best fit for parametric, non-parametric, and discrete distributions. For the parametric approach, the distfit library can determine the best fit across 89 theoretical distributions.

WebApr 11, 2024 · Once we have our model we can generate new predictions. With a Bayesian model we don't just get a prediction but a population of predictions. Which we can visualise as a distribution: Which... WebMar 11, 2015 · exponential distribution in a robust way, but I never tried. (one idea would be to estimate a trimmed mean and use the estimated distribution to correct for the trimming. scipy.stats.distributions have an `expect` method that can be used to calculate the mean of a trimmed distribution, i.e. conditional on lower and upper bounds)

WebApr 5, 2024 · $\begingroup$ scipy has a more general distribution. If you want the two parameter distribution, then just fix the third parameter. But I don't see why you need to complain that scipy uses the 3 parameter distribution in the loc-scale family given that it allows the use of the 2-parameter distribution as a special case. $\endgroup$ –

Webf = Fitter(height, distributions=['gamma','lognorm', "beta","burr","norm"]) f.fit() f.summary() Here the author has provided a list of distributions since scanning all 80 can be time consuming. f.get_best(method = … sharebilityWebDistribution is actually a breeze with Python, no longer do you need to be a statistics and programming whiz to code these things up. Scipy has that all covered for you! Distribution fitting is usually performed with a technique called Maximum Likelihood Estimation (MLE) — essentially, this finds the “best-fit” parameters to any single ... share big files onlineWebApr 19, 2024 · How to Determine the Best Fitting Data Distribution Using Python. Approaches to data sampling, modeling, and analysis can vary based on the … share bid priceWebFeb 21, 2024 · Fitting probability distributions to data including right censored data Fitting Weibull mixture models and Weibull Competing risks models Fitting Weibull Defective Subpopulation (DS) models, Weibull Zero Inflated (ZI) models, and Weibull Defective Subpopulation Zero Inflated (DSZI) models pool hours holiday inn expressWebMay 11, 2016 · 1 Two things: 1) You don't need to write your own histogram function, just use np.histogram and 2) Never fit a curve to a histogram if you have the actual data, do a fit to the data itself using scipy.stats – … share big files with friendsWebJun 15, 2024 · The fitted distributions summary will provide top-five distributions that fit the data well. Based on the sumsquared_error criteria the best-fitted distribution is the normal distribution. f = Fitter (data, … share bicycleWebNov 18, 2024 · The following python class will allow you to easily fit a continuous distribution to your data. Once the fit has been completed, this python class allows you … share big files free online